Sherman Oaks, CA: Wilmar Publishers, [1973]. Hardcover. Near Fine/Very Good. 8vo. xiv, 248 pp. Bound in orange cloth, title stamped in black on cover and spine, in green dust jacket printed in black. Black and white frontispiece and illustrations throughout. Near Fine, bright, clean copy, in Very Good dust jacket with wear to extremities and overall scuffing.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all.
